UV laser protective glasses, the main feature of this type of glasses is the specialized UV filter. These filters are able to absorb or reflect a very high percentage of ultraviolet rays, without disturbing the user’s vision of the environment or the object in question. The lenses of these glasses are usually made of advanced polycarbonate; a resistant, lightweight and very transparent material that guarantees both comfort and safety.

Contrary to popular belief, the use of laser safety glasses is not just for the machine operator. In environments where other people are active near the machine, especially in workshops or production lines, the general use of safety glasses is considered part of the professional safety standard.
Ergonomic design and comfort are other advantages of these glasses. The frames are usually made in a way that they fit well on various face shapes, prevent side light from entering, and at the same time, do not cause pressure or discomfort. Adjustable straps, flexible frames, and the ability to be installed over prescription glasses are among the features seen in professional models.
Many UV protective glasses also have international approvals such as ANSI, CE or EN207, which indicate the standard of protection and the quality of the materials used. Therefore, when choosing this type of glasses, it is important to pay attention to the approvals, the type of wavelengths that can be filtered, the lens color and the type of application (medical, industrial, research).
Applications
- Working with UV laser devices in industrial or laboratory engraving
- Photolithography operations in the electronics and semiconductor industries
- Working with UV light sources for disinfection or UV printers
- Protection in medical and research laboratories when working with ultraviolet sources
